    Also, for those interested, I believe the virus file came from either TheFreeYouTubeDownloader, EasyWebExplorer, or TrafficSpace but I cannot be sure.

    At first I tried removing it manually, but it re-installed itself, so I used a removal tool.
    The removal tool used was MalwareBytes and it cleaned it up rather easily.
